Expert AI · Mechanic's Insight
The vehicle’s most recent MOT on 2025-10-07 at 17,964 miles recorded a pass, but a conflicting fail entry on the same date complicates interpretation. Previous tests from 2024-10-03 (14,807 miles) and 2023-10-02 (10,729 miles) showed no defects, indicating a stable maintenance trend. The lack of recorded issues in the last three years suggests consistent compliance, though the duplicate fail entry raises questions about data accuracy. The car’s mileage of 17,964 miles over nine years equates to approximately 1,996 miles annually, significantly below average. This low usage may indicate infrequent operation, which can lead to component degradation from inactivity, such as corrosion in the exhaust system or seized suspension bushes. The MOT history shows regular testing intervals, but the absence of mileage progression details between 2022-09-14 (6,944 miles) and 2023-10-02 (10,729 miles) suggests potential gaps in recorded data. A buyer should verify the vehicle’s structural integrity, particularly for rust in the underbody and chassis, given the low mileage. Inspect the suspension system for hardened bushes or coil spring fatigue, as prolonged inactivity can accelerate wear. The brake system, including discs and calipers, should be checked for corrosion or binding, as low-mileage vehicles may develop uneven wear. Confirm the exhaust system’s condition, as stagnant operation can cause internal rust. The conflicting MOT records necessitate cross-referencing with DVSA archives to validate the 2025 test outcome.
